In a message dated 8/14/2002 7:27:24 AM Central Daylight Time, [EMAIL PROTECTED] writes: I will be in San Antonio from the 23rd through the 25th. I have a friend who is willing to be a tour guide for me in San Antonio. She seems to know her way around the place. Anyway, any ideas, suggestions, places to see, places to photograph, eat, etc., etc., etc., will be greatly appreciated. Also, any good camera shops around? Totally unfamiliar with Fort Worth, so all my comments apply to San Antonio. Camera shops: Not the best city in the world for those. We have a friendly one, not exceptionally well-stocked -- Boyd's, at the corner of Blanco Road and Lockhill-Selma. We have a well-stocked one with a reputation for unfriendliness -- Camera Exchange on San Pedro Ave. By the way, in case you do want to visit those shops, be aware neither one is open on Sundays. Places to see: World-class zoo (with miniature railroad that is or was the world's longest); four 18th-century missions (in addition to the Alamo -- the Shrine of Texas Liberty. The other four are less touristy and in fact all the chapels are still in regular use as chapels); some nice and some truly horrific architecture. I may have even more ideas when I'm a bit more awake :-) I just happen to have spent a lot of time shooting the zoo and the missions. Of course there's also the Riverwalk. Places to eat: Recommendations would depend on what you like to eat. Ken Archer will probably have additional suggestions.
